Fraxinus
16.5.0-fx-rc6
An IGT application
|
Classes | |
struct | BufferStore |
Public Types | |
typedef boost::shared_ptr< BUFFER > | BufferPtr |
typedef boost::weak_ptr< BUFFER > | BufferWeakPtr |
Public Member Functions | |
BufferQueue () | |
void | setMaxBuffers (unsigned val) |
void | setName (const QString &name) |
BufferPtr | get (DATA_PTR data) |
int | getMemoryUsage (int *textures) |
Definition at line 421 of file cxGPUImageBuffer.cpp.
typedef boost::shared_ptr<BUFFER> cx::BufferQueue< DATA_PTR, BUFFER >::BufferPtr |
Definition at line 424 of file cxGPUImageBuffer.cpp.
typedef boost::weak_ptr<BUFFER> cx::BufferQueue< DATA_PTR, BUFFER >::BufferWeakPtr |
Definition at line 425 of file cxGPUImageBuffer.cpp.
|
inline |
Definition at line 435 of file cxGPUImageBuffer.cpp.
|
inline |
Get a GPU buffer for the input data. Try to reuse existing memory if available.
Definition at line 452 of file cxGPUImageBuffer.cpp.
|
inline |
Definition at line 509 of file cxGPUImageBuffer.cpp.
|
inline |
Definition at line 439 of file cxGPUImageBuffer.cpp.
|
inline |
Definition at line 443 of file cxGPUImageBuffer.cpp.